The Truth About Penis Size |
|
Myth #1: Bigger is better. Not necessarily so. Because most men become aroused visually,
men have concluded that the larger the sexual organ, the bigger the turn on (the media,
including the porn industry, perpetuates this myth). Most men are surprised to learn that the
average size length of an erect penis is between 5.1- 6.2 inches depending on the study. The
reality is that some women are actually frightened by very big penises, and most women just
don't attach very much importance to size. When it comes to turning on a woman, technique
trumps penis size every time!
Myth #2: I need a large penis to please a woman. The vagina is very elastic, so a woman's vagina can accommodate a big or a small penis. Most vaginas are only 3-4 inches deep and all vaginas remain collapsed when nothing is inside of them. Because the most sensitive part of the vagina is the opening, where she has a concentration of nerve endings, the sensations that a bigger penis may cause aren't that different from those produced by a smaller penis. Additionally, a woman who keeps her pelvic floor toned and vaginal opening tight with kegel exercises wont even feel the difference. Obviously if a man has an unusually small penis, a woman may not feel it very much, which is a problem, however still not insurmountable as most women need direct clitoral stimulation to achieve an orgasm which is most effectively done with a vibrating toy, tongue or hand. As I said earlier, a man who enjoys pleasuring his partner with a toy or various other body parts has little to worry about. Myth # 3: I can make my penis larger with gadgets or supplements. Men often ask me, “How can I make my penis bigger?”. There actually is one way to achieve a larger penis (excluding surgery). It is available for all men find themselves at least 15 pounds overweight. Although most of the penis is visible, part of the penis is buried beneath the skin and is called the crus. If a man has excess fat in his pubic area, then part of the length of his penis is buried beneath the skin. With weight loss, a man will expose a greater portion of his penis, thus his penis “grows”. The approximation doctors use is one inch of erect penis length gain for every 30 pounds lost. For a fresh perspective, and more accurate perspective, on your penis size, try looking at yourself standing naked in front of a mirror (instead of looking down). You might be surprised by how much larger you penis looks from this perspective (as its seen by others). When you look down, foreshortening (a trick of the eyes) occurs, which is an optical illusion making your penis appear smaller than it really is. Myth #4: My penis is misshapen because it's curved. Finally, if your penis is curved when erect, your penis is perfectly normal! Men who don't know this often think something is wrong with their penis and feel self-conscious about it. Trust me, penises curve and bend in every direction when erect. If you are concerned, however, see a Urologist for peace of mind. The ratio of crus (penis under the skin) to exposed penis will cause variation in the direction that a penis points during an erection. Men with a shorter crus, thus a longer penis, are more likely to have an erection that points downward, while a penis that has a longer crus will point outward or even strait out when erect. Bottom line, your sex appeal is determined by many factors, least of which is penis size. Focus on improving sexual technique, increasing emotional intimacy and developing confidence as a lover and youʼll have a fully satisfied partner! |
